Cost-Effective Solutions for Ventilation Fans  

Cost-effectiveness in industrial ventilation fans extends beyond the initial purchase price. To achieve long-term savings, consider the energy efficiency of the fans. Fans that utilize EC (electronically commutated) technology, for instance, can significantly reduce energy consumption compared to traditional AC motors. This not only lowers operational costs but also contributes to environmental sustainability. 

When evaluating cost-effective solutions, also consider the total cost of ownership, which includes installation, maintenance, and potential downtime costs. Selecting fans designed for easy installation can save time and labor expenses. Additionally, inquire about the expected lifespan of the fans and the availability of replacement parts to minimize future expenses. 

Customization options can also enhance cost-effectiveness. For instance, if a specific airflow rate is required for your facility, a manufacturer may provide tailored solutions that meet your exact specifications without the need for additional equipment or modifications. 

Common Problems with Industrial Ventilation Fans and Their Solutions 

Despite their critical role, industrial ventilation fans can encounter various problems. One common issue is airflow inconsistency, which can result from improper sizing or installation. It's crucial to calculate the required airflow based on the facility's size and function. Engaging a knowledgeable supplier can help you determine the correct fan size and configuration. 

Another frequent problem is motor overheating, often caused by inadequate ventilation or improper fan placement. To address this, ensure that the fan is installed in a location that allows for proper airflow around the motor. Regular maintenance checks can also prevent overheating by ensuring that dust and debris do not obstruct the fan’s operation. 

Vibration and noise issues can also arise, typically due to misalignment or wear and tear. Implementing a routine maintenance schedule that includes alignment checks and lubrication can mitigate these problems. Comparing Different Types of Industrial Ventilation Fans for Your Needs 

When comparing different types of industrial ventilation fans, it's essential to understand the specific applications and performance characteristics of each type. Centrifugal fans, for instance, are ideal for applications requiring high pressure and airflow, making them suitable for large factory settings. In contrast, axial fans are more efficient for low-pressure applications and can be used in spaces where noise levels must be minimized. 

Consider the fan's intended use, as different designs cater to various requirements. For example, if the fan will be used in a system that requires a constant airflow rate, selecting a fan with variable speed control can optimize performance and energy efficiency.
